Part-Time Lifeguard- New Bedford High School
New Bedford Public SchoolsNew Bedford, MA, United States- Part-time
Job Description: This position is responsible for ensuring safety and protecting lives by preventing and responding to emergencies. Performance Responsibilities: Maintain the safety of the patrons in and around the pool Communicate and enforce all pool rules in a personable and professional manner Communicate any potentially dangerous elements of the facility to the Pool Director Perform patron surveillance with a rescue tube from the guard stand Remain alert and use all senses while guarding Work as a team with other lifeguards Handle all incidents in a manner appropriate to your training Make sure all emergency equipment is on the pool deck before classes start (backboard, first aid bag, rings, poles etc.) Return to the office at the end of the day. Perform other duties as assigned The duties listed above are intended only as illustrations of the various types of work that may be performed. The omission of specific statements of duties does not exclude them from the position if the work is similar, related or a logical assignment to the position. The job description does not constitute an employment agreement between New Bedford Public Schools (NBPS) and employee and is subject to change by NBPS as the needs of NBPS and requirements of the job change. Competencies: Communication Proficiency Independent Judgement Integrity Customer Service Digital Literacy Creativity Teamwork & Collaboration Adaptability Sensitivity to Others Required Skills and Abilities: Minimum age is 16 years old. Active Lifeguard/CPR/AED/First Aid certificate required, American Red Cross preferred Working knowledge of equipment, facilities, operations, and techniques used in lifeguarding. Ability to manage crowds, swimmers, and water activities and enforce rules and regulations.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with employees, supervisors, patrons, and public. Ability to communicate effectively orally, ability to give and understand oral instructions. Tools and Equipment Used Various hand tools used in the maintenance of a pool, water safety equipment, phones, and radios.
